Usually Carley Fortune books are either hits or misses for me, so I always go in with lowered expectations. Unfortunately, this one just wasn’t a favorite. I didn’t hate it, but I also didn’t love it. It was still an enjoyable read overall—I finished it quickly and there were moments I liked—but I kept wishing there was more.

The main character especially didn’t fully work for me. I had a hard time connecting with her and wished we saw more growth beyond the constant references to Little Women. After a while, it started to feel repetitive instead of adding depth to her personality.

The romance also didn’t completely land for me. I wanted more emotional tension and chemistry because I never fully felt invested in the relationship. It had potential, but I kept waiting for that stronger connection to click and it just never really did.

Overall, it wasn’t a bad read by any means—just one that left me wanting a little more emotionally from both the characters and the romance.
